What's the difference between Chaumet and Le Baiser Du Dragon?+
Chaumet is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Chaumet (1999) dominated by Woody accords. Le Baiser Du Dragon is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Cartier (2003) leaning on Almond accords. They share 5 accords: Woody, Fruity, Sweet, Warm Spicy.

Which season suits Chaumet vs Le Baiser Du Dragon?+
Chaumet scores highest for spring wear; Le Baiser Du Dragon scores highest for fall wear. Chaumet leans daytime, Le Baiser Du Dragon leans evening.
